Another addition is the ability to enable the "HTML mode" for the Button component. In this mode, the button's action occurs in the context of `user action`, allowing operations like "copy and paste text" "show the keyboard" and more. However, in this mode, the button only responds to regular clicks due to the technical implementation of it (so no double clicks or long taps).

@ -1,47 +0,0 @@
|
||||
-- Copyright (c) 2021 Maksim Tuprikov <insality@gmail.com>. This code is licensed under MIT license
|
||||
|
||||
--- Druid module with utils on string formats
|
||||
-- @local
|
||||
-- @module helper.formats
|
||||
|
||||
local const = require("druid.const")
|
||||
|
||||
local M = {}
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
--- Return number with zero number prefix
|
||||
-- @function formats.add_prefix_zeros
|
||||
-- @tparam number num Number for conversion
|
||||
-- @tparam number count Count of numerals
|
||||
-- @return string with need count of zero (1,3) -> 001
|
||||
function M.add_prefix_zeros(num, count)
|
||||
local result = tostring(num)
|
||||
for i = string.len(result), count - 1 do
|
||||
result = const.ZERO .. result
|
||||
end
|
||||
return result
|
||||
end
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
--- Convert seconds to string minutes:seconds
|
||||
-- @function formats.second_string_min
|
||||
-- @tparam number sec Seconds
|
||||
-- @return string minutes:seconds
|
||||
function M.second_string_min(sec)
|
||||
local mins = math.floor(sec / 60)
|
||||
local seconds = math.floor(sec - mins * 60)
|
||||
return string.format("%.2d:%.2d", mins, seconds)
|
||||
end
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
--- Interpolate string with named Parameters in Table
|
||||
-- @function formats.second_string_min
|
||||
-- @tparam string s Target string
|
||||
-- @tparam table tab Table with parameters
|
||||
-- @return string with replaced parameters
|
||||
function M.interpolate_string(s, tab)
|
||||
return (s:gsub('($%b{})', function(w) return tab[w:sub(3, -2)] or w end))
|
||||
end
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
return M
